My 93sv with livescope has started having a ghost tree about the middle of the screen. Will a update fix this? Also what is the easiest way to update the unit?
I update using a SD card. The newer updates have a ghost tree setting. That’s if you have a UHD unit. Not sure about the plus units. It didn’t really seem to help mine. I adjust gain more than anything to fade the ghost tree in and out.
The “Ghost Tree” is a inherent artifact in Garmin’s phased array LiveScope Sonar technology (notice how the 3 limbs in the ghost tree approximately line up with the flat surface angles on the LVS32 xducer) ...
Sometimes turning up TVG or Noise Rejection can minimize the ghost tree artifact ... but realize these higher settings also reduce target distinction ... it’s a balancing act ...

I am just so used to the ghost tree it doesn't bother me. But I can fish the same brush pile and get the tree and the next day it will be gone with same the settings. A lot of things make the gt appear and disappear, like water quality and shallow water.
